WebIn bilateral cataracts, the eye with greatest vision impairment from cataract is operated on first. First-eye surgery can improve vision and quality of life. However, it is unclear whether or not cataract surgery on the second eye provides enough incremental benefit to be considered clinically effective and cost-effective. WebJul 13, 2024 · The first things you notice after cataract surgery are dramatic improvements in color and light. The majority of cataracts become yellow-brown in color. You don't notice this (because cataracts cause a slow decline in vision), but this causes a yellow-brown hue to your vision. It is only after cataract surgery that things appear much more ... Cataracts don’t typically advance at the same rate in both eyes, and cataract surgery can be scheduled ... sims 4 midnitetech career packWebCataracts are cloudy areas that form on your eye’s lens. Age-related cataracts are the most common type. Symptoms include blurry vision and glare around lights. Cataract surgery removes your clouded lens and replaces it with a clear artificial lens called an IOL.
